Background
The skeleton partition wall is also called as keel partition wall, and mainly uses timber or steel to form the skeleton, and then two sides are made into surface layers. The light partition skeleton formed by installing panels on two sides of a partition keel consists of an upper sill, a lower sill, vertical ribs, transverse ribs (also called crosspieces), inclined struts and the like. The distance between the vertical ribs depends on the specification of the used material, the horizontal ribs are set according to the specification of the plate material along the height direction between the vertical ribs by using the material with the same section, and the two ends are tightly supported and nailed so as to increase the stability. The surface layer material is usually used for light sheets such as fiber boards, gypsum plasterboard, plywood, calcium plastic boards, plastic aluminum boards, fiber cement boards and the like. The method for fixing the panel and the framework can adopt nails, expansion bolts, rivets, self-tapping screws or metal clips according to different materials, and can be used for matching and installing curved door and window structures on curved wall bodies in buildings.
